The Office of Investments

Under the oversight of the CFO, Paul Ellinger, the Office of Investments oversees the investment of the University System’s Operating and Endowment assets, including farmland donated to the University.

Operating and Endowment assets are invested through carefully selected external investment firms, while farmland is primarily managed internally by the Agricultural Property Services department.

$122.2M was distributed to System Units in FY23.

SAFEKEEPING ASSETS

The investment objective for the Endowment Pool is to preserve the purchasing power of pool assets and provide annual support for an infinite period.

The investment objective for the Operating Pool is to preserve the value of the principal, maintain liquidity appropriate to the forecasted working capital requirements of the System, provide prudent diversification and maximize the rate of return on investment.

The Endowment Pool ranked in the top decile relative to peers for the 10 year period as of June 2020.
